Pacolet, SC – One Killed, One Injured in Crash on Jerusalem Rd

Pacolet, SC (June 1, 2024) – A motor vehicle accident reported in Union County claimed one person’s life. The collision was reported to law enforcement at around 1:50 p.m. on Thursday, May 30.

Official reports indicate that two vehicles collided head-on while traveling on Jerusalem Road. The involved vehicles, a 2011 Honda sedan and a 2015 Chevrolet sedan, both came to rest on the roadway near Countryside Drive. The driver of the Chevrolet was pronounced deceased while at the scene. Authorities have not yet publicly identified the victim. The Honda driver was injured as a result of the crash. EMS transported the victim to a local hospital. At this time, the incident is under investigation.

In South Carolina, damage awards are based on the doctrine of comparative negligence. This law allows families to recover compensation for losses and damages caused by another person’s negligence, even if the deceased is partially at fault.
